Finding aids are detailed guides that describe the contents of a specific archival collection. They provide historical context and a detailed inventory of the boxes and folders we hold, helping you pinpoint exactly what materials you need before you visit.

Please note: The finding aids available below represent only a limited part of our total archives. As we continue to process and reorganize our materials, we are slowly building this digital library. Planning Your Research Visit

To ensure our volunteer staff can properly assist you, research access to our collections is by appointment only.

If you identify materials in our finding aids that support your work, please review our research policies before requesting a visit:

  • Document Your Scope: Your specific research scope and the exact folders you wish to view must be documented and reviewed by the RHS Collections Committee prior to scheduling your appointment.
  • Research Session Fees: To help fund the ongoing preservation of our archives, the following fees apply per research session:
    • Members: $20
    • Non-Members: $30
    • Students: Free

(Please note: All on-site research must take place on the first floor in our designated public spaces.)
